Compartir vía


sysschemaarticles (Transact-SQL)

Se aplica a: SQL Server

Realiza un seguimiento de los artículos de solo esquema para publicaciones transaccionales y de instantáneas. Esta tabla se almacena en la base de datos de publicación.

Nombre de la columna Tipo de datos Descripción
artid int Identificador del artículo.
creation_script nvarchar(255) Ruta de acceso y nombre de un script del esquema del artículo que se utiliza para crear la tabla de destino.
descripción nvarchar(255) La entrada descriptiva del artículo.
dest_object sysname Nombre del objeto en la base de datos de suscripciones si el artículo es de solo esquema, como un procedimiento almacenado, una vista o una UDF.
name sysname Nombre del artículo de solo esquema de una publicación.
objid int Identificador de objeto del objeto base del artículo. Puede ser el identificador de objeto de un procedimiento, una vista, una vista indizada o una UDF.
pubid int Identificador de la publicación.
pre_creation_cmd tinyint Especifica lo que debería hacer el sistema si detecta un objeto existente con el mismo nombre en el suscriptor cuando se aplica la instantánea para este artículo:

0 = Nada.

1 = Eliminar tabla de destino.

2 = Quitar tabla de destino.

3 = Truncar la tabla de destino.
status int Mapa de bits utilizado para indicar el estado del artículo.
type tinyint Valor que indica el tipo de artículo de solo esquema:

32 = Procedimiento almacenado.

64 = Vista o vista indizada.

96 = Función de agregado.

128 = Función.
schema_option binary(8) Máscara de bits de la opción de generación del esquema para el artículo dado. Especifica la creación automática del procedimiento almacenado en la base de datos de destino para todas las sintaxis CALL/MCALL/XCALL, y puede ser el resultado OR bit a bit lógico de uno o más de estos valores:

0x00 = deshabilita el scripting por el Agente de instantáneas y usa creation_script.

0x01 = Genera la creación de objetos (CREATE TABLE, CREATE PROCEDURE, etc.). Este valor es el predeterminado en los artículos de procedimientos almacenados.

0x02 = Genera procedimientos almacenados personalizados para el artículo, si se define.

0x10 = Genera un índice agrupado correspondiente.

0x20 = Convierte los tipos de datos definidos por el usuario en tipos de datos base.

0x40= Genera índices no clúster correspondientes.

0x80= Incluye la integridad referencial declarada en las claves principales.

0x73 = Genera la instrucción CREATE TABLE, crea índices agrupados y no agrupados, convierte tipos de datos definidos por el usuario en tipos de datos base y genera scripts de procedimientos almacenados personalizados que se aplicarán en el suscriptor. Este valor es el predeterminado en todos los artículos excepto en los de procedimientos almacenados.

0x100= Replica desencadenadores de usuario en un artículo de tabla, si se define.

0x200= Replica restricciones de clave externa. Si la tabla a la que se hace referencia no forma parte de una publicación, no se replicará ninguna restricción de clave externa de una tabla publicada.

0x400= Replica restricciones check.

0x800= Replica los valores predeterminados.

0x1000= Replica la intercalación de nivel de columna.

0x2000= Replica las propiedades extendidas asociadas al objeto de origen del artículo publicado.

0x4000= Replica claves únicas si se definen en un artículo de tabla.

0x8000= Replica la clave principal y las claves únicas en un artículo de tabla como restricciones mediante instrucciones ALTER TABLE.
dest_owner sysname Propietario de la tabla de la base de datos de destino.

Consulte también

Tablas de replicación (Transact-SQL)
Vistas de replicación (Transact-SQL)